Just got this email from Google...Thought I'd Share
Dear Google Apps admin,​ In order to continue to improve our products and deliver more sophisticated features and performance, we are harnessing some of the latest improvements in web browser technology. This includes faster JavaScript processing and new standards like HTML5. As a result, over the course of 2010, we will be phasing out support for Microsoft Internet Explorer 6.0 as well as other older browsers that are not supported by their own manufacturers. We plan to begin phasing out support of these older browsers on the Google Docs suite and the Google Sites editor on March 1, 2010. After that point, certain functionality within these applications may have higher latency and may not work correctly in these older browsers. Later in 2010, we will start to phase out support for these browsers for Google Mail and Google Calendar. Google Apps will continue to support Internet Explorer 7.0 and above, Firefox 3.0 and above, Google Chrome 4.0 and above, and Safari 3.0 and above. Starting this week, users on these older browsers will see a message in Google Docs and the Google Sites editor explaining this change and asking them to upgrade their browser. We will also alert you again closer to March 1 to remind you of this change. In 2009, the Google Apps team delivered more than 100 improvements to enhance your product experience. We are aiming to beat that in 2010 and continue to deliver the best and most innovative collaboration products for businesses. Thank you for your continued support! Sincerely, The Google Apps team

Why is everyone assuming Apple’s ban on Flash is supposed to drive traffic to the app store?
It’s a glib explanation, but it doesn’t make sense to me, and here’s why. Crucial fact: * **Nothing prevents you from installing web apps on the iPhone without going through the app store.** The widespread assumption, as I understand it, is that banning Flash forces developers to rewrite their SWFs as iPhone apps, which can then only be distributed on the app store after receiving explicit approval from Apple. Right? The problem is, that only applies to “native” UIKit apps, because web apps have never been subject to this process of dictatorial control. And an HTML5 web app can do just about anything a Flash app can do (the only exception I know of is recording through the camera and mic, please correct me on this). It will usually do it faster and better, *and* it will install directly to the home screen just like anything from the app store. So if you’re porting a Flash app to the iPhone, you can avoid the approval process and charge whatever you like without giving a single penny to Apple. If you’re so inclined. Oh, I know, HTML5+JS in WebKit wasn’t *always* as capable as Flash. If you had a Flash app a couple years ago you wanted to port to the iPhone, you might’ve needed UIKit for some things, and you’d have had to submit to Apple’s approval process and distribution scheme. But remember, the app store didn’t even *exist* for the first year after the iPhone was released. Every third-party application was supposed to be a web app running under WebKit (exactly like Google’s vision for Chrome OS, incidentally). Developers were supposed to target open standards like scriptable SVG and <canvas>, not UIKit or Flash. That vision turned out to be premature, in 2007, because WebKit on iPhone OS 1.0 wasn’t quite up to the task. But now it’s 2010, WebKit and HTML have evolved, and you no longer need UIKit for the kind of animations and interactivity Flash provides. Moreover, on the desktop, the installed base of HTML5-capable browsers is growing. Software written to any device-specific API, including UIKit, is getting less relevant. So for the types of applications that use Flash, as well as many more complex apps, UIKit is already overkill and on the way out—do people think nobody at Apple realizes that? I’m not saying Apple doesn’t want developers writing for UIKit. The app store is profitable, for one thing, and the number of apps targeting UIKit provides a form of vendor lock-in. But here’s the specific point regarding Flash: * **Keeping Flash off the iPhone has nothing to do with skimming off profits from the sale of iPhone apps, because you are perfectly free to sell non-Flash apps without going through Apple’s app store.** I know Reddit as a whole has been suffering from collective retardation on this topic, but does that at least make sense to you folks? *** Things Flash can do that a web app can’t: * Camera and mic input * Realtime DSP * DRM What else?

A message from STANFORD UNIVERSITY Message sent - 2/1/2010 In the early morning hours of Saturday, January 30th, a Stanford student struck up a conversation with a stranger at a bar in Palo Alto near the campus. The stranger, a male, suggested that they go out for food. The student drove the stranger to a McDonald's in East Palo Alto. The stranger then asked the student if he could crash at the student's residence. The student refused, so the stranger got out of the student's vehicle. Unbeknownst to the student, the stranger left a bag of personal items in the student's car. Upon discovering the bag, the student took it to the Stanford Police (on Monday, February 1) so that it could be returned to the stranger. Among the items in the bag, the police located a pair of handcuffs and lighter fluid. The officers were able to ascertain the identity of the stranger and, after some investigation, determined that the individual did not appear to pose a threat to the student or the community.
